1. Embracing Agile Methodologies for Rapid Iteration
Gone are the days of lengthy, waterfall-style development cycles. In 2026, agile methodologies are the bedrock of successful technology projects. Agile emphasizes iterative development, frequent feedback, and adaptability. By breaking down large projects into smaller, manageable sprints, teams can quickly respond to changing requirements and market demands. Tools like Jira and Asana are invaluable for managing agile workflows.
A core principle of agile is the sprint retrospective. At the end of each sprint, the team reflects on what went well, what could be improved, and what changes to implement in the next sprint. This continuous improvement loop is crucial for optimizing performance and delivering high-quality results. For example, a development team might realize during a retrospective that their daily stand-up meetings are too long and unfocused. They could then experiment with a shorter, more structured format.
Furthermore, agile promotes cross-functional collaboration. Developers, designers, testers, and product owners work closely together throughout the entire development process. This ensures that everyone is aligned on the goals and that potential problems are identified early on. This approach minimizes misunderstandings and reduces the risk of costly rework.

2. Prioritizing User Experience (UX) in Development
In the crowded digital landscape of 2026, user experience (UX) is paramount. Users expect intuitive, seamless, and engaging experiences. If your technology fails to deliver, they will quickly move on to a competitor. Investing in UX research, design, and testing is essential for creating products that resonate with your target audience.
User research is the foundation of good UX. This involves understanding your users’ needs, behaviors, and motivations. Techniques such as user interviews, surveys, and usability testing can provide valuable insights. For instance, a company developing a new mobile app might conduct user interviews to identify the key features that users would find most valuable. They might also conduct usability testing to identify any pain points in the app’s user interface.
Usability testing is crucial for identifying and resolving usability issues. This involves observing users as they interact with your product and identifying any areas where they struggle. Tools like Hotjar can provide valuable insights into user behavior, such as where users are clicking, how long they are spending on each page, and where they are dropping off.
Accessibility is another critical aspect of UX. Your technology should be accessible to all users, regardless of their abilities. This includes ensuring that your website and applications are compatible with assistive technologies, such as screen readers. Following accessibility guidelines, such as the Web Content Accessibility Guidelines (WCAG), is essential for creating inclusive and user-friendly experiences.
3. Data-Driven Decision Making with Analytics
In 2026, gut feelings are no longer sufficient. Data-driven decision making is essential for optimizing performance and achieving business goals. By collecting and analyzing data from various sources, you can gain valuable insights into customer behavior, market trends, and operational efficiency. Tools like Google Analytics provide powerful capabilities for tracking website traffic, user engagement, and conversion rates.
Key Performance Indicators (KPIs) are essential for measuring progress and identifying areas for improvement. These are specific, measurable, achievable, relevant, and time-bound metrics that track the performance of your technology initiatives. For example, a company might track the number of website visitors, the conversion rate of leads to customers, and the customer satisfaction score.
A/B testing is a powerful technique for optimizing website and application design. This involves creating two versions of a page or feature and testing which one performs better. For example, a company might A/B test different headlines on their website to see which one generates the most clicks. Or they might test different button colors to see which one leads to more conversions.

4. Cybersecurity as a Core Business Function
With the increasing sophistication of cyber threats, cybersecurity is no longer just an IT concern, it’s a core business function. Protecting your data, systems, and reputation from cyberattacks is essential for maintaining customer trust and ensuring business continuity. This requires a multi-layered approach that includes technical controls, employee training, and incident response planning.
Regular security audits are essential for identifying vulnerabilities and weaknesses in your systems. These audits should be conducted by independent security experts who can provide an objective assessment of your security posture. Penetration testing, also known as ethical hacking, simulates a real-world attack to identify vulnerabilities that could be exploited by malicious actors.
Employee training is crucial for preventing social engineering attacks, such as phishing and ransomware. Employees should be trained to recognize and report suspicious emails, links, and attachments. They should also be educated on the importance of strong passwords and multi-factor authentication.
Incident response planning is essential for minimizing the impact of a cyberattack. This involves developing a detailed plan that outlines the steps to be taken in the event of a security breach. The plan should include procedures for identifying, containing, and eradicating the threat, as well as for recovering data and systems.
5. Cloud Computing Optimization for Scalability
Cloud computing provides unparalleled scalability, flexibility, and cost-effectiveness. However, simply migrating to the cloud is not enough. To truly realize the benefits of cloud computing, you need to optimize your cloud infrastructure and applications for performance, security, and cost. This involves selecting the right cloud providers, services, and configurations.
Cost optimization is a critical aspect of cloud management. Cloud costs can quickly spiral out of control if not properly managed. Tools like cloud cost management platforms can help you track your cloud spending, identify cost-saving opportunities, and automate cost optimization tasks. For example, you can use these tools to identify unused resources, right-size instances, and schedule resources to be turned off during off-peak hours.
Performance optimization is essential for ensuring that your applications run smoothly in the cloud. This involves monitoring the performance of your cloud resources and identifying any bottlenecks or performance issues. You can then use various techniques, such as caching, load balancing, and database optimization, to improve performance.
Security optimization is crucial for protecting your data and applications in the cloud. This involves implementing security controls, such as firewalls, intrusion detection systems, and data encryption. You should also regularly audit your cloud security posture to identify and address any vulnerabilities.
6. Automation and AI-Driven Efficiency
In 2026, automation and AI are transforming the way businesses operate. By automating repetitive tasks and leveraging AI-powered insights, you can improve efficiency, reduce costs, and free up employees to focus on more strategic initiatives. This includes automating tasks such as data entry, customer service, and software testing.
Robotic Process Automation (RPA) is a powerful technology for automating repetitive tasks that are typically performed by humans. RPA bots can be programmed to perform tasks such as data entry, invoice processing, and customer service inquiries. This can free up employees to focus on more complex and creative tasks.
AI-powered chatbots can provide instant customer support and answer frequently asked questions. This can improve customer satisfaction and reduce the workload on human customer service agents. Chatbots can be trained to handle a wide range of inquiries, from basic product information to complex technical support issues.
AI-driven analytics can provide valuable insights into customer behavior, market trends, and operational efficiency. AI algorithms can analyze large datasets to identify patterns and anomalies that would be difficult for humans to detect. This can help you make better decisions and improve your business performance.

How can I measure the success of my agile implementation?
You can measure the success of your agile implementation by tracking metrics such as sprint velocity, burndown rates, customer satisfaction scores, and the number of defects found in production. Regularly reviewing these metrics will provide insights into the effectiveness of your agile processes.
